Chemicals used for pH, bacteria, taste and odour control such as hydrated lime, activated carbon and soda ash are delivered in various forms. At Spiroflow, we have the equipment to suit all applications whether dosing chemicals from silos, bulk bags or sacks. Bulk bag dischargers can be fitted with massagers for poor flowing products such as hydrated lime. This is particularly important for dosing stations that are un-manned for long periods of the day. Our systems eliminate dust and environmental contamination, they can handle and dose chemicals using either loss-in-weight or volumetric metering.

A wide range of conveyors may be used to achieve very accurate dosing with rates as low as 1kg/hr. Providing an even and consistent material flow, the Spiroflow systems can eliminate bridging of material and consequent starvation of the conveyor leading to the slurry tank.

Spiroflow works very closely with world leaders in Ejector Technology and this offers one of the most reliable, accurate and cost effective way of introducing solids into a liquid stream.

 

 Latest Development
Spiroflow, working together with ejector specialist Transvac Systems Ltd, has been quick to respond to the requirement for Containerised Dosing Systems whereby the solids additive handling system, the dosing ejector and all controls including safety and alarm systems are housed in a 20ft ISO Container. This approach massively reduces the cost of water treatment in those situations where a building would otherwise have to be erected. And, of course, they are mobile and can be available for transfer to any location at short notice to deal with a seasonal or emergency situation.

 

Benefits of Spiroflow dosing systems: 

A. Bulk Bag Discharger

  1. Bulk Bag loaded: into support frame at ground level, directly into the discharger using our special hanging frame or hoisted into place using an integral lifting beam and travelling hoist.
  2. Dust-free discharge of chemicals from Bulk Bag.
  3. Reliable, unaided discharge of chemicals even from compacted bags.
  4. Integral Flexible Screw Conveyor transfers chemicals to a buffer hopper.
  5. Low level alarm indicates when bag needs replacing. The dosing system can be designed to include a buffer hopper holds enough material to satisfy overnight demand until bag can be replaced during the following day.
  6. Designed and manufactured by Spiroflow, pioneers of Bulk Bag Discharging for over 20 years.






B. Flexible Screw Conveyors

  1. Uncomplicated, highly reliable design, only one moving part. No bearings or seals to fail. Trouble-free operation is ensured.
  2. Totally contained conveying, no exhaust air filtration required. 
  3. High accuracy volumetric metering from 1kg to several 100kgs / hour.
